Beautifully made vintage Japanese Kutani plates circa pre-war Showa Period (1930s), featuring a hand-painted scene of a scholar teaching his young student while admiring the beautiful bamboo scenery. Well painted border with iron red glaze and gilt details. We have 5 of these plates available. 


First established in 1655, Kutani ware has a long history as one of Japan’s best pottery manufacturing areas, and gained prominence in 1873 when it was exhibited at the World Exposition in Vienna.
